Peas and onions

Frozen, cooked, boiled, drained, with salt

Carbs 74%Protein 22%
Percent Calories

½ cup of peas and onions (Frozen, cooked, boiled, drained, with salt) contains 41 Calories The macronutrient breakdown is 74% carbs, 4% fat, and 22% protein. This is a good source of vitamin k (9% of your Daily Value).
